Investigation into Shaolin Temple Abbot

  • πŸ—‚οΈ Shi Yongxin, the abbot of the 1,500-year-old Shaolin Temple, is under investigation by multiple agencies.
  • ⚠️ Allegations include embezzlement, improper relationships with women, and fathering illegitimate children.

Commercialization of Shaolin Temple

  • πŸ’° Since taking over in 1999, Shi Yongxin has transformed the temple into a global commercial empire.
  • πŸ“ˆ This commercial direction, involving movies, stage shows, and tourism, has led to criticism that the temple has become a money-making exercise.
  • πŸ“£ Critics argue that a historical and cultural institution like Shaolin should not be solely for profit.

Revocation of Clergy Certificate

  • πŸ“œ China's top Buddhist authority has revoked Shi Yongxin's clergy certificate, which is proof of monastic acceptance.
  • πŸ“‰ This action follows a deepening criminal probe into the allegations.
  • πŸ“’ The Buddhist Association of China stated that Shi Yongxin's actions have seriously damaged the reputation of the Buddhist community.

Previous Allegations

  • πŸ”„ This is not the first time Shi Yongxin has faced allegations of corruption and embezzlement; similar claims were made in 2015.
  • 🚫 At that time, the allegations were dismissed.
